What is Magnolia Oil & Gas Pretax Margin %?

Pre-Tax margin is calculated as Pre-Tax Income divided by its Revenue. Magnolia Oil & Gas's Pre-Tax Income for the three months ended in Dec. 2023 was $145 Mil. Magnolia Oil & Gas's Revenue for the three months ended in Dec. 2023 was $323 Mil. Therefore, Magnolia Oil & Gas's pretax margin for the quarter that ended in Dec. 2023 was 45.07%.

Magnolia Oil & Gas Pretax Margin % Calculation

Pretax margin - also known as pretax profit margin is the ratio of Pretax Income divided by net sales or Revenue, usually presented in percent.

Magnolia Oil & Gas's Pretax Margin for the fiscal year that ended in Dec. 2023 is calculated as

Pretax Margin=Pre-Tax Income (A: Dec. 2023 )/Revenue (A: Dec. 2023 )
=549.812/1226.979
=44.81 %

Magnolia Oil & Gas's Pretax Margin for the quarter that ended in Dec. 2023 is calculated as

Pretax Margin=Pre-Tax Income (Q: Dec. 2023 )/Revenue (Q: Dec. 2023 )
=145.4/322.628
=45.07 %

Magnolia Oil & Gas  (NYSE:MGY) Pretax Margin % Explanation

The pretax margin, as know as pretax profit margin, is widely used to measure the operating efficiency of a company before deducting taxes.

The pretax margin is sometimes preferred over the net margin as tax expenditures can make profitability comparisons between companies misleading.

It is a useful tool to compare companies operating in the same sector and less effective when comparing companies from other sectors as each industry generally has different operating expenses and sales patterns.

The long term trend of the pretax margin is a good indicator of the competitiveness and health of the business.

Magnolia Oil & Gas Corp is an independent oil and natural gas company engaged in the acquisition, development, exploration, and production of oil, natural gas, and natural gas liquid (NGL) reserves. The Company's oil and natural gas properties are located in Karnes County and the Giddings area in South Texas, where the Company targets the Eagle Ford Shale and Austin Chalk formations. Its objective is to generate stock market value over the long term through consistent organic production growth, high full-cycle operating margins, and an efficient capital program with short economic paybacks. The company's operating segment is acquisition, development, exploration, and production of oil and natural gas properties located in the United States.
